Autumn in Dollar Glen
Dollar Glen is a beautiful gorge set into the eastern flank of the Ochils. At the head sits Castle Campbell. A 15th century tower built for the Campbells of Argyll (who fought their neighbours, the Clan Lamont in 1645-46). The glen is at its best in Autumn with a range of trees producing a fantastic…
